WITH Australia’s first match of the upcoming 2008 Toyota International Rules Series against Ireland just eight days away, the players that turned up for a light training session looked like they meant business.

While one might have thought training would serve purely as a meet-and-greet for those in attendance at Arden Street, coach Mick Malthouse and his players looked serious.

While some, such as captain Brent Harvey and his deputy Hawk Campbell Brown have considerable experience at the hybrid game, others were having their first kick with the round ball.

Brown, the Hawthorn hardman and now premiership player, might be entering his second International Series, but he stayed out longer than anyone following the hour-long session, practising kicking the strange football around his body for goal.

Others, like his Hawk teammate Brad Sewell, were simply trying to come to grips with the round ball for the first time.

Other Aussies involved in Thursday’s session included Bulldog Matthew Boyd, Tiger Nathan Foley, Magpie Scott Pendlebury, Blue Kade Simpson and Kangaroo Daniel Wells, who perhaps looked most adept with the Gaelic ball.

Whether it was the fact he was on familiar turf, or whether it was just his silky skills shining through, only time will tell.

Assistant coaches Nathan Buckley and Matthew Lappin were also present to lend guidance when it came to kicking the round ball, having both represented their country on several occasions.

By midday the session was over. Next time the players train they’ll not only be more comfortable with the round ball, but they’ll have a few more teammates to keep them company as well, as the side gets ready for the first test on October 24.
